It is a quite typical portuguese municipal flag, with the coat of arms centered on a background gyronny (meaning city rank) of red and white. The coat of arms is gules, between two fleurs de lis or, a tower argent masoned sable and open of the same metal. Mural crown argent with five visible towers (city rank) and white triply folded scroll reading in black upper case letters "NOTÁVEL | VILA FRANCA DE XIRA | CIDADE".

Vila Franca de Xira municipality had 106 880 inhabitants in 1990, and it is divided in 11 communes, covering 294 km2. It belongs to the Lisboa District and to the old province of Ribatejo.

It is a quite typical portuguese communal flag, with the coat of arms centered on a background gyronny (city rank) of red and blue. The coat of arms is argent, awavy bend of the same fimbriated azure between two crescents gules pointing upwards. Mural crown argent with five visible towers (city rank) and white scroll reading in black upper case letters «CIDADE DE ALVERCA DO RIBATEJO».

Alverca do Ribatejo commune belongs to the Vila Franca de Xira municipality, to the Lisbon District and to the old province Ribatejo.
